Sorry, don't know this system well very well, inherited last spring.

Have Partner R6 setup for company. Added two new external lines and want these to be a sep company. What's best way to have them (VMS or AA) so that they go to sep voice mail and never default to operator?

Auto Attendant 1 has several menus and is being used for company one. It's not assigned anywhere so I assume it's a default.

I tried 206 VMS cover but ring no answer and transfers to operator. Also tried 310.

In 206 group 7 set them to Assigned and not VM cover. You don't need 310 assigned to the Voice Mail ports, also check 506 1 for day and 2 for night for rings that you want before the AA answers.

Depends on your voice mail. Some will allow you to specify the "dial-0/timeout" option for each auto attendant, some have it globally set as ext. 10. Also inside of a mailbox, if you have a setting for "personal operator", have all the people in company B set their's to company B's operator - otherwise if a caller in a mailbox presses 0, they will get company A's operator.
